Today, RIX Riga Airport signed a cooperation memorandum with the Aviation Academy of South Korea’s Incheon International Airport Corporation (IIAC), one of the leading aviation training centres in the Asia-Pacific region. This partnership marks a significant step in implementing the development strategy of Riga Airport’s training centre, RIX Academy, to enhance its global visibility and attract a broader range of trainees.
Chairperson of the Board of Riga Airport Ms. Laila Odiņa: “This memorandum is a strategic step that will enable us to reinforce international cooperation and offer training programmes of the highest quality. By combining the European-standard expertise and experience of RIX Academy — an Airports Council International (ACI) accredited training centre — with the competencies of the Incheon Aviation Academy, we will gain new opportunities to export our knowledge to external markets and attract clients on a global scale.”
The memorandum provides for extensive cooperation, including the joint development and implementation of new training programmes and courses, instructor exchanges and competency development, the promotion of training activities, and collaboration in the field of human resource development.
About RIX Academy
RIX Academy is the training centre of Riga Airport, offering professional aviation training. The centre provides more than 160 training programmes in aviation security, ground handling, airfield operations, crisis management, and other aviation fields. Each year, RIX Academy trains more than 15,000 specialists from Latvia and abroad. Since 2017, RIX Academy has been an Airports Council International (ACI) accredited training centre, offering internationally recognized courses and tailor-made training solutions for various companies. In 2023, RIX Academy joined the family of ACI Accredited Training Partners.
